WebWhen compared to other types of tea, oolong has a moderate amount of caffeine. A cup of oolong tea usually contains anywhere from 12 mg to 55 mg of caffeine. This range is lower than that of black teas, which can contain up to 90 mg in one cup. Green tea has the least amount of caffeine out of all three types, with an average of 35 mg per cup.
